I was introduced to quilt making by a fellow ex-pat Mum, while teaching in overseas.

On returning to the U.K. I went looking for some classes, and jumped feet first into City and Guilds in Patchwork and Quilting. This was closely followed by the same in Machine Embroidery.

It was while completing a project for the Patchwork and Quilting course that I discovered the joys of fabric painting. I continue to explore colouring my own fabric.

I am drawn to the tactile possibilities of cloth and stitch and while my practise used to be all about the sewing machine I am now drawn, more and more, to hand stitching .

While my work is grounded in technique I am always open to the ‘What If’ philosophy of making in my textile art and quilted pieces.

I enjoy sharing my knowledge and encouraging others, aiming to help learners of all levels find their unique voice through fabric and thread and I encourage all to embrace imperfections as part of the creative journey.
